Job Description

Major Recruitment are currently recruiting for Quality Inspectors to work for a well-established client based in Wednesbury.Working hours: Full-Time Monday to Friday, weekly rotating shift patternsPay rate : £11.66ph for the first 4 weeks rising to £14.15 / £15.02ph after 4 weeksWorking days: Monday to Friday - rotating weekly on 6am till 2pm / 2pm till 10pm / 10pm till 6am shiftsAre you a passionate Quality Inspector, looking for a new opportunityMain Responsibilities for the Quality Inspector :-

  • Ensuring quality products are delivered to the customer & all faults are reported back to Production in a timely manner.
  • Accurate recording of faults, Investigate and determining causes of them for resolution ensuring products meet the customer’s expectations & requirements.
  • Ensure processes conform to ISO 9001:2015 standards to ensure full integration into the business quality management system or IATF 16949 for automotive customer/s.
  • Ensure focus on health and safety using PPE is maintained whilst conducting given tasks.
  • Support improvement quality processes
  • Participate in drive forward Continuous Improvement initiatives where required.
